About the Role We are seeking a Zuora Product Owner within the Revenue and Deal Operations organization to drive the strategy, design, and optimization of subscription billing and quote‑to‑cash capabilities. This role sits within Revenue & Deal Operations (RDO) and serves as a key cross‑functional partner across Salesforce, Kantata, Revenue Operations, Finance, and technology teams to deliver scalable, customer‑centric solutions that support a global sales organization and a rapidly growing subscription business. This role is critical to supporting a multi‑billion‑dollar revenue organization undergoing rapid growth and transformation. You will lead the product lifecycle for Zuora and its integration with Salesforce, enabling seamless execution of the quote‑to‑cash process while ensuring billing, customer, and revenue data requirements are supported across connected systems. The role will collaborate closely with teams responsible for ERP, e‑billing/e‑reporting, and reconciliation capabilities to ensure Zuora processes, integrations, and data flows align with broader operational, compliance, and business requirements. Key Responsibilities Own the Zuora product roadmap, including billing, subscriptions, invoicing, and revenue integrations Lead end‑to‑end product lifecycle from ideation through delivery and ongoing optimization Partner with Sales, Revenue Operations, Finance, IT, Sales Ops, and adjacent Product Owners to define product strategy, requirements, priorities, and aligned business outcomes Coordinate shared dependencies across e‑billing, reconciliation, Salesforce, Kantata, ERP/Fusion, and other connected quote‑to‑cash systems Drive integration between Salesforce (Sales & Service Cloud) and Zuora to optimize quote‑to‑cash processes Gather, define, and prioritize business requirements aligned with revenue operations objectives Translate business, operational, compliance, and system needs into clear user stories, acceptance criteria, and delivery priorities Collaborate with SCRUM teams to deliver high‑quality product increments and MVPs Analyze usage data, billing metrics, and user behaviors to inform product improvements Support organizational change management including training, communication, and adoption strategies Ensure scalability and accuracy across subscription lifecycle including billing, invoicing, and revenue recognition Manage risks, dependencies, and cross‑functional alignment to ensure successful product delivery across highly connected quote‑to‑cash systems Qualifications Bachelor's Degree required 3-6 years of experience in Product Management, Product Ownership, or Business Systems roles Hands‑on experience with Zuora Billing and/or Zuora Revenue strongly preferred Experience with Salesforce.com or similar CRM platform Strong understanding of quote‑to‑cash and subscription business models Proven experience leading cross‑functional initiatives in Agile/SCRUM environments Strong analytical, problem‑solving, and decision‑making skills Experience with analytics tools such as Tableau or Power BI is a plus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ills Who You Are A proactive, high‑performing individual with a bias for action A strong collaborator who can influence across business and technical teams Comfortable navigating ambiguity in fast‑paced environments Passionate about delivering customer‑centric solutions and continuous improvement A clear communicator with strong interpersonal skills What We Offer Competitive salary, generous paid time off policy, charity match program, Medical, Dental & Vision Plans, Parental Leave, Employee Assistance Program (EAP), 401K matching and more!
